FreeScout — это бесплатная служба поддержки и общий почтовый ящик, созданный с помощью PHP-фреймворка Laravel. До версии 1.8.211 манипуляция заголовком хоста в версии FreeScout (http://localhost:8080/system/status) позволяла злоумышленнику внедрить произвольный домен в сгенерированные абсолютные URL-адреса. Это приводит к загрузке внешних ресурсов и открытому перенаправлению.
Когда приложение создает ссылки и ресурсы, используя непроверенный заголовок Host, пользовательские запросы могут быть перенаправлены в домены, контролируемые злоумышленниками, а внешние ресурсы могут загружаться с вредоносных серверов. Эта проблема исправлена в версии 1.8.211.
Показать оригинальное описание (EN)
FreeScout is a free help desk and shared inbox built with PHP's Laravel framework. Prior to version 1.8.211, host header manipulation in FreeScout version (http://localhost:8080/system/status) allows an attacker to inject an arbitrary domain into generated absolute URLs. This leads to External Resource Loading and Open Redirect behavior. When the application constructs links and assets using the unvalidated Host header, user requests can be redirected to attacker-controlled domains and external resources may be loaded from malicious servers. This issue has been patched in version 1.8.211.
Характеристики атаки
Последствия
Строка CVSS v3.1
Тип уязвимости (CWE)
Уязвимые продукты 1
| Конфигурация | От (включительно) | До (исключительно) |
|---|---|---|
|
Freescout Freescout
cpe:2.3:a:freescout:freescout:*:*:*:*:*:*:*:*
|
— |
1.8.211
|